Pietrame Montepulciano D'Abruzzo
Tasting Notes
Pietrame Montepulciano d'Abruzzo is a bold, energetic red wine crafted from 100% estate-grown Montepulciano grapes indigenous to the rugged hills of Italy's central eastern Abruzzo region. Produced by the renowned Cantina Tollo cooperative, the standard "spring" expression is kept unoaked and refined in stainless steel vats for up to twelve months to capture the grape's pure, vibrant varietal characteristics. In the glass, it displays a deep ruby red color flashing brilliant violet reflections. The wine opens with a highly expressive bouquet featuring prominent aromas of wild cherry, fresh plum, and dark woodland berries, beautifully complexed by delicate notes of earthy violets, peppery spice, and subtle hints of cocoa. On the palate, it delivers a full-bodied yet remarkably well-structured profile where rich flavors of juicy blackberry, licorice, and savory herbs roll over a core of vibrant, mouth-watering acidity. The finish is remarkably smooth, sustained by gentle, tightly coiled tannins that cleanly wash the palate without feeling overly heavy.
Thanks to this robust structure and high natural acidity, this wine is exceptionally food-friendly and shines alongside hearty, savory Italian cuisine. It perfectly cuts through the fat and richness of heavy, tomato-based dishes like baked lasagna layered with extra cheese, meat-lover's pizza, and eggplant parmigiana. The wine's earthy and peppery undertones also complement smoky, charred proteins straight from the barbecue, making it an excellent companion for grilled Italian fennel sausages with peppers, thick burgers, and roasted lamb chops. For simpler arrangements, it pairs beautifully with cured charcuterie boards and semi-mature to hard cheeses like Parmesan, Asiago, or Pecorino.
